- The distance between Naryn (Mtn Stn), Kyrgyz Republic and Greenville, Pa, Usa is approximately 10,535 km or 6,547 mi.
- To reach Naryn (Mtn Stn) in this distance one would set out from Greenville, Pa bearing 17.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Naryn (Mtn Stn) bearing 162.1° or SSE .
- Naryn (Mtn Stn) has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Greenville, Pa has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Naryn (Mtn Stn) is in or near the boreal dry scrub biome whereas Greenville, Pa is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 5.5 °C (10°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.2 °C (13°F) more in Naryn (Mtn Stn). The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 688 mm (27.1 in) less which is equivalent to 688 l/m² (16.89 US gal/ft²) or 6,880,000 l/ha (735,518 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.4° lower in Naryn (Mtn Stn) than in Greenville, Pa.
